logo

Output 2c84d2933a47251fbdc459dd9bfc8c181823863a776eff05f81d28084bfab52e:1

value
911919779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3acc68995790b65b58606569d00ae52f6b4b0404 OP_EQUAL
address
373uzEAKjMW18XNTNpqweSKEWSz5jqH9J8
transaction
2c84d2933a47251fbdc459dd9bfc8c181823863a776eff05f81d28084bfab52e